Oran is a city of 600,000+ people in Northwest Algeria. [edit] UnderstandOran's beautiful sea shore, constructed under French rule, was inspired by Nice's seafront. It consists of a long boulevard lined with cafés, restaurants, and ice cream shops. The boulevard also offers a splendid view of the sea, the harbour, Santa Cruz and the cliffs ("les Falaises"). It has been renamed "Boulevard de l'ALN" by the government after the independence but it is still called Front de Mer by the locals. [edit] By trainOran is at the western terminus of the Algerian rail network, there is a line continuing towards [Marocco]] but it has been closed for decades due to political conflicts. Trains from the capital Algiers are plentiful however with several services daily. The city has always been the capital of Algeria's parties and music. All night long, plenty of nightclubs, bars and cabarets are opened and offer music, dance and partying in the city area seafront, called La Corncihe which runs from the city's Front de Mer to the neighbouring cities of Aïn El Turk, Bou Sfer and El Ançor. All kinds of nightclubs can be found, from the very posh Atmosphère at the Sheraton Hotel that attracts now international DJs such as David Vendetta to more popular ones in the Corniche. The city centre is full of boutiques, the zone is called "Les Arcades" and there can be found food, souvenirs, clothing, arts and crafts, music... Another zone is "Mdin Jdida", it is a huge market where all Oranese go for shopping. A mall is to open soon near the Airport in Es-Senia. [edit][add listing] Eat[edit] Budget
